*{margin:0;padding:0}

body,input,select,select option,textarea{font-family:tahoma,arial,sans-serif;font-size:14px}

html{height:100%;background:#51a4e6}

body{line-height:1.2;color:#fff;min-height:100%;position:relative}
* html body{height:100%}

img{border:0}

table{border-collapse:collapse}

a:link,a:visited{color:#fff;text-decoration:underline}
a:hover{color:#fff;text-decoration:none}

.game_main{min-width:980px;padding:0 0 125px 0;background:url(../images2/game1_bg3.gif) 0 0 repeat-x}
.game_main .game_mn1{background:url(../images2/game1_logo.jpg) 100% 0 no-repeat}
* html .game_main .game_mn1{height:300px}

.game_logo{height:300px;background:url(../images2/game1_logo.png) 50% 0 no-repeat}
* html .game_logo{background:none;width:100%;overflow:hidden;position:relative}
.game_logo ins{display:block}
* html .game_logo ins{fil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src=images2/game1_logo.png, sizingMethod=scale);
width:1270px;height:295px;position:absolute;top:0;left:50%;margin:0 0 0 -635px}
.game_logo ins i{display:block;width:940px;margin:0 auto;padding:19px 0 0 30px}
.game_logo ins i a{display:block;width:244px;height:36px;padding:10px}
.game_logo ins i a img{display:block}

.game_content{width:970px;margin:0 auto}

div.game_description{width:902px;margin:0 auto}
table.game_description{width:100%}
table.game_description .video{vertical-align:top;padding:0 30px 33px 0}
table.game_description .text{vertical-align:top;padding:0 0 33px 0;line-height:1.3}
table.game_description .text p{padding:0 0 1em 0}
table.game_description .text big{font-size:18px}

.game_screens{height:185px;background:/*url(../images2/game1_bg4.gif) 50% 0 no-repeat*/none;padding:37px 0 0 0}
.game_screens .in1{width:902px;margin:0 auto;overflow:hidden;height:160px}
.game_screens .in2{width:1200px}
@media all and (min-width:0px){
noindex:-o-prefocus,.game_screens .in1{position:relative}
noindex:-o-prefocus,.game_screens .in2{position:absolite;top:0;left:0}}
.game_screens a{float:left;margin:0 25px 0 0;position:relative;width:160px;height:160px}
.game_screens a img{display:block;padding:4px}
.game_screens a i{display:block;position:absolute;top:0;left:0;background:url(../images2/game1_screen.png) 0 0 no-repeat;
width:160px;height:160px;overflow:hidden;text-indent:-9999px;cursor:pointer}
* html .game_screens a i{background:none;
fil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src=images2/game1_screen.png,sizingMethod=scale)}

.optionsLine{width:902px;margin:0 auto;padding:25px 0 40px 0;zoom:1}
.optionsLine:after{content:' ';clear:both;display:block;width:0;height:0;overflow:hidden;font-size:0}
.optionsLine .appleStore{float:left;}
.optionsLine .appleStore a{display:block;width:111px;height:55px;background:url(../images2/marketingBadge.png) 0 0 no-repeat;
overflow:hidden;text-indent:-9999px;}
.optionsLine .discuss{font-size:24px;text-align:right;float:right;}

.foot{position:absolute;left:0;bottom:0;width:100%;height:125px;background:url(../images2/game1_bg1.gif) 0 100% repeat-x}
.foot .in1{background:url(../images2/game1_bg2.gif) 50% 100% no-repeat;height:125px}
.foot .in2{padding:82px 40px 0 40px;background:url(../images2/game1_copy.gif) 0 83px no-repeat;width:820px;
margin:0 auto;font-family:tahoma,arial,sans-serif;font-size:12px;color:#fff;line-height:13px}